The Capon Bridge Public Library is hosting an educational program dedicated to the life and impact of Capt. David Pugh. This presentation offers attendees a deep dive into local history, exploring the contributions and legacy of this significant figure. It is an excellent opportunity for history enthusiasts and community members to learn more about the region's past in an engaging and informative setting.
